## Market notes
**Germany (DE)**
- Default consumption: 3500 kWh/year
- Prices are Arbeitspreis brutto ct/kWh including MwSt (19%)
- Netzentgelt not included — same regardless of provider choice
**United Kingdom (GB)**
- 30-min Agile pricing via Octopus
- Unit: p/kWh (pence)
- Sub-zones GB-A..GB-P available
**Australia (AU)**
- 5-min NEM dispatch pricing
- cheapest\_hours unavailable — no public day-ahead data
- Zones: AU-NSW, AU-VIC, AU-QLD, AU-SA, AU-TAS
**New Zealand (NZ)**
- 30-min NZEM pricing
- cheapest\_hours unavailable — no public day-ahead data
- Zones: NZ-NI (North Island), NZ-SI (South Island)

## Data sources
- ENTSO-E Transparency Platform — Nordic + DE spot prices, updated hourly
- Octopus Agile API — GB 30-min prices
- AEMO — AU 5-min NEM prices
- EM6 — NZ 30-min prices
